Turtle Creek’s homes are older than most in Allegheny County, with 98.0% built before 1980 and a homeownership rate under 37% (U.S. Census Bureau, ACS 2024). That means most HVAC projects here are either retrofits or replacements in houses where ductwork—if it exists—was often fitted for an old gravity furnace or patched in later. Tighter, older spaces usually mean adding or modifying ducts, solving returns that are too small, or working around electrical panels that never expected modern loads.

With 5,600 heating degree days and only 1,050 cooling degree days, southwest Pennsylvania is soundly in a heating-dominated climate. Reliable heat is always the first priority, but nearly every house built after the 1940s has at least some cooling needs as insulation and occupancy go up. Choosing the right system means matching the home’s era, layout, and fuel options to the right price and efficiency range.

Duct condition, leakage and sealing

In Turtle Creek, a typical home’s ductwork was never designed for today’s HVAC standards. Most pre-1960 houses have ducts that started life as add-ons or were sized for a coal or oil furnace, not for modern high-velocity air conditioning or heat pumps. Leaks are rarely obvious but almost always present—especially at unsealed seams, splices, and disconnected runs behind walls or in basements. Duct leakage wastes conditioned air, with some older systems losing enough to reduce total output by 20% or more.

A duct blaster test is the objective way to measure how much air your ducts are leaking. The test isolates your duct system, pressurizes it, then quantifies exactly how much air escapes. This information tells you if simple sealing with mastic or foil tape will get the job done, or if portions need to be re-run or replaced altogether.

Undersized return-air ducts are a chronic but mostly invisible problem in retrofitted homes, especially if cooling was added long after the original heat. When your system “starves” for air on hot or cold days, it strains—and wastes energy. Duct runs through unconditioned attics or crawlspaces are also common and lose both heat and cool unless properly insulated.

The right move is to test ducts before replacing your equipment. Upgrading the system without addressing duct loss just moves old problems onto expensive new gear. In these old houses, what you don’t see can cost you year after year.

Gas, electric or both in southwestern Pennsylvania

Allegheny County’s climate asks for robust heating first, with a winter design temperature of 8 °F and 5,600 heating degree days a year. While long ago it was common wisdom that heat pumps couldn’t keep up with Pennsylvania’s cold snaps, that’s now outdated. Modern cold-climate heat pumps maintain useful capacity down below freezing, but their output still drops as outdoor temps fall—such as on a 10-degree Turtle Creek morning. That’s why backup or dual-fuel systems remain practical here.

Natural gas is widely available through Peoples Gas for much of the county, and this shapes the local market. Where you have gas on site, a high-efficiency furnace continues to deliver the lowest upfront cost and reliable heat on the coldest days. If you’re outside natural gas territory—using propane or fuel oil instead—the economics are very different. Here, an air source or cold-climate heat pump can beat the cost and convenience of delivered fuel.

Dual fuel (a heat pump paired with a gas furnace) gives you the best of both: efficient electric heating down to the low 30s, then automatic gas backup for the “polar vortex” spells. Go with a gas furnace if you’re on the gas grid and want bulletproof reliability or low upfront cost. Heat pumps are a smart all-electric choice if you’re outside gas distribution or leaning toward electrification.

Efficiency ratings and what they mean for your bill

Every new HVAC system comes with two main efficiency ratings: SEER2 for cooling, and HSPF2 for heating. SEER2 measures seasonal cooling efficiency—higher is better, but the premium for pushing SEER2 above the mid-to-high teens rarely pays back unless you run the AC 24/7 all summer. HSPF2 covers heat pump efficiency in heating mode, which is the more meaningful rating in southwestern Pennsylvania’s 5,600 heating degree day climate.

For Turtle Creek, investing in a unit with 16–18 SEER2 is the real sweet spot; you’ll find little financial return pushing for 20 or higher unless your home is unusually large or you have high electric rates. For heat pumps, you want HSPF2 of at least 9, and a true “cold climate” unit will deliver even better performance in the teeth of a January cold snap.

It’s worth noting that the ratings changed in recent years from SEER and HSPF to the stricter SEER2 and HSPF2, making older efficiency numbers hard to compare directly to today’s units. For our region, don’t chase the absolute highest SEER2. Prioritize robust heating performance and insulation upgrades where possible instead.

Sizing: why bigger is worse

Sizing the system right is the most important thing a Turtle Creek contractor can do. In old homes, there’s a strong temptation to oversize—especially since older units were often oversized to start with. But “more is safer” is a myth. Oversized HVAC units cycle on and off too quickly (“short cycling”), causing big temperature swings, clammy air, poor humidity control, higher energy bills, and shorter equipment life. It also means you’re paying for capacity you’ll never actually use.

A proper load calculation, called Manual J, takes into account each home’s square footage, construction, insulation, window quality, orientation, and air leakage—not just a rough “tons per 500 square feet.” This is crucial in Turtle Creek since most houses were built for a 1950s lifestyle and may have changed little since. Your system should be set up for a winter design temperature of 8 °F, as that’s the coldest stretch you need to reliably heat through.

Don’t let anyone size equipment based on the old nameplate or a ballpark guess. The question to ask any contractor: “Did you run a load calculation, and can I see it?” If they didn’t, they’re copying mistakes from the past. Right-sizing protects your investment and your comfort.

Mechanical permits for HVAC work in Turtle Creek

Pennsylvania does not license HVAC trades statewide for residential work. Instead, the Pennsylvania Uniform Construction Code (UCC) sets minimum standards, and enforcement—including permits and inspections—happens at your city or borough level. In places like Turtle Creek, most major HVAC installations (including replacements or significant alterations) require a mechanical permit. These local permits ensure work follows energy, venting, and safety codes regardless of who does the work.

Every contractor working with refrigerants must have EPA Section 608 certification, a federal requirement. Beyond that, anyone taking on a project over $500 must be registered as a Home Improvement Contractor (HIC)—always verify this status at hic.attorneygeneral.gov. For workers’ compensation insurance, you can check contractor coverage through WCAIS at wcais.pa.gov; coverage is mandatory for all employers, and you should never skip this step.

Always ask for proof of HIC registration, active insurance, and workers’ compensation confirmation before any deposit changes hands. Residential permitting safeguards local homes, especially given the complexity of Turtle Creek’s older housing stock.

Humidity and air quality in Turtle Creek homes

With cold winters and humid summers, Turtle Creek homes see both extreme dryness and muggy months in the span of a year. In winter, subzero wind chills dry out indoor air fast, leading many to consider whole-house humidifiers. These can help but bring a maintenance burden—neglecting to clean or change pads routinely can create more harm than good.

In summer, humidity control hinges on your cooling setup. Oversized air conditioners cool the house too fast to pull moisture out of the air, leaving the place clammy. That’s why sizing and correct fan speed matter as much as any “air quality” add-on.

Don’t overpay for extras: high-MERV filters can slow blower airflow and should match your system’s capacity, not just a catalog number. Mechanical ventilation (air exchangers or ERVs) can help in newer, tightly sealed homes. But for most of Turtle Creek’s older houses, natural air leakage usually makes extra ventilation unnecessary.

Some air cleaners, UV lights, and ozone generators are oversold and offer little practical benefit compared to regular filter changes and addressing moisture at the source.

Frequently asked questions — HVAC installation in Turtle Creek

Are duct sealing and insulation eligible for incentives? For Turtle Creek households, duct sealing and insulation can sometimes qualify for utility or state efficiency incentives when bundled with a broader HVAC upgrade—especially if you install a high-efficiency heat pump or central AC in the $4,700–$16,000 range. The specific offers change often, so check with your utility or a local contractor with up-to-date program links. Incentives are much more robust for complete system upgrades than for duct sealing alone. In older homes, duct sealing is wise for energy and comfort, with or without outside incentives. Don’t let a promised rebate drive the work—focus on the improvements that will actually matter in your house.
How much does a new HVAC system cost in Turtle Creek? A new HVAC system in Turtle Creek can cost anywhere from $4,700–$17,000, depending on the type of system, the condition of any existing ductwork, and your home’s electrical capacity. For homes with good ducts already in place, replacing a central AC typically runs $4,700–$11,500. Modern ducted heat pumps generally come in higher, while a full new duct system plus heating and AC will approach the top of the range. Local factors like tight basements and old wiring in pre-1960 homes can add to both cost and complexity. Always insist on a written quote after an on-site inspection for Turtle Creek’s unique housing stock.
Do I need to be home during installation? For most HVAC installations in Turtle Creek, it’s recommended that the homeowner be present at the start of the job for a walkthrough. This lets you confirm equipment placement, access routes, and anything fragile or off-limits. Once work is underway, you don’t have to be there every minute—many homeowners go about their day. But it's smart to return before job completion, especially if ducts are being added or moved ($8,500–$17,000) or if large equipment is being installed. A final walkthrough lets you ask questions, check that everything works, and ensure the crew didn’t miss anything before cleanup. In older Turtle Creek homes, jobs often require small on-site decisions best made by the owner.
What size HVAC system does my Turtle Creek home need? The right size HVAC system for your Turtle Creek home depends on a Manual J load calculation—never just the square footage or a label on your old unit. Most local homes were built before modern insulation and window standards, and each retrofit is unique. Sizing from the old equipment risks carrying forward mistakes that lead to short cycling, high bills, and uneven comfort. Trust a contractor who performs a proper load calculation, especially with pre-1960 construction and a winter design temperature of 8 °F. Going too big is as big a problem as too small. Sizing isn’t tied directly to price, but most equipment falls in the $4,700–$16,000 band depending on configuration.
How do I verify an HVAC contractor's insurance? In Pennsylvania, including Turtle Creek, all HVAC contractors working on residential jobs over $500 must have Home Improvement Contractor registration, plus workers’ compensation if they have employees. Before signing any contract or paying a deposit, request a certificate of insurance—this should show both liability and workers’ compensation coverage. You can further confirm workers’ compensation status using the state’s WCAIS system at wcais.pa.gov. For HIC registration, verify their number at hic.attorneygeneral.gov. These checks cost you nothing but can save you tremendous headaches, whether your job is a ductless mini-split under $6,600 or a full system.
Should I repair or replace my HVAC system in Turtle Creek? In Turtle Creek’s older housing stock, repairs make sense for systems less than 10 years old or when the fix is modest relative to replacement—like a capacitor or small control part. But for units approaching 15–20 years, or when the repair bill approaches half the cost of a new unit ($4,700–$11,500 for central AC), replacement is usually better economically, especially given efficiency gains and potential rebates. If ductwork is leaky or you’re worried about electrical capacity, a fresh system may also address problems the old one could never solve. Always compare the cost of repair vs. what a new system would bring in comfort and energy savings.
How often should I change my filter? Most Turtle Creek homes use standard 1-inch filters, which should be checked every month and changed at least every 2–3 months—sometimes more often if you have pets or the house is dusty from ongoing work. With older duct systems, regular filter changes are even more important to protect equipment and maintain air quality. Upgrading to a larger (4-inch) media filter can extend change intervals but only if your system is designed for it. Neglecting filters shortens the lifespan on any system, whether a basic furnace or a new install in the $7,500–$16,000 range. Mark your calendar or set a phone reminder so you don’t forget.
How much does ductwork add to an HVAC installation? Installing new ductwork in a Turtle Creek home, if ducts are missing or must be fully replaced, typically adds between $8,500–$17,000 to the total job cost—on top of the HVAC equipment itself. This range accounts for site-built runs through finished plaster walls, routing through short basements or attics, and sealing to modern standards. Homes with tight crawlspaces, old returns, or no central chases see higher costs. If your ducts are usable, only minor repairs and sealing may be required (much less). Full duct replacement is usually only needed in homes that originally had no forced air or where old ducts are rusted out or badly undersized.
Which utility serves Turtle Creek? Turtle Creek’s electricity is provided by Duquesne Light Company, and most homes have natural gas from Peoples Gas, as is typical through much of Allegheny County. If you’re considering all-electric options or want to compare heating choices, it’s important to know whether you have existing gas service or rely on propane or oil, as this changes both operating costs and payback time for different systems. The price of natural gas means a gas furnace with AC (total $4,700–$11,500) is often still the most cost-effective solution for homes already connected to the main lines.
